Description
CRAWLEY BRIGHTON ROAD TQ 23 NE Lowfield Heath 3/80a Crown-post barn to east of Rowley Farm House GV II Barn. Late mediaeval. Timber framed with weatherboarded cladding and plain tile roof, with hip to west. Five bays. Centre entries, with later window inserted above doorway in the long yard elevation, which has outshut to west of entry and later lean-to to east. Two windows in east gable. In rear elevation, two late C19 or early C20 windows in second bay from west, one each in third, fourth and fifth bays from west. Internally, barn retains jowl posts, tie beam braces and a crown-post roof with square section posts with upward braces of rectangular section; the roof also has side purlins, perhaps inserted when the tile roof was added, possibly replacing thatch. The wall framing and studding is partly concealed by modern boarding; the western-most bay is floored over.
